Gin Rummy
"Gin Rummy" is a classic and engaging card game where the goal is to strategically arrange your hand into sets and runs. Place your cards in either groups of the same rank or in sequential order of the same suit. Score points by eliminating these combinations from your hand. The game ends when a player reaches the target score, typically set at 100 points.
Mastering Gin Rummy
Never played Gin Rummy before?
Essentially, the goal of Gin Rummy is to have less deadwood than your opponent, or ideally, no deadwood at all. Your deadwood amount becomes your opponent's points. If your opponent's points exceed 100, you lose. Conversely, if you reach 100 points before your opponent, you win.
